Welcome

The Campaign for Real Ale (CAMRA) is a
well-established, national organisation with more than 100,000 members, which aims to promote traditional real
ale and pubs.
CAMRA is organised into local branches run by volunteers; you have reached the home page of the
York branch, Yorkshire's oldest. We cover an extensive geographical area, which includes
Selby, Tadcaster and rural parts of North and East Yorkshire, as well as the city of York itself. Our members
participate in a lively programme of social events, produce a regular
newsletter and stage an annual
beer festival.

With the most recent Beer & Pub Association report highlighting that 39 pubs are closing every week, CAMRA has to do more than ever to support local pubs through these difficult times.
CAMRA's own research shows that 84% of people believe a pub is as essential to village life as a shop or post office. Despite their popularity pubs are still under threat and need our help.
CAMRA is calling on everyone to join the Save Our Pubs campaign to put a stop to the closure of British pubs.

Real
ale in a bottle is is the next best thing to the draught real ales you can enjoy at the pub. The beer is unpasteurised
and is not artificially carbonated. It is a natural live product with wonderful fresh flavours and a pleasant, natural
